What's the total of your Capital One CLI for your secured card?

I talked to Capital One about my card that's stuck on a $500 limit. The supervisor that I spoke to implied that these cards don't typically get high limits because they're meant to help people improve their score so that they can get other cards. The person that I spoke to before the supervisor also implied that people are expected to apply for other cards after the secured card has served its purpose.

 

Just wanted to read about your experiences with your secured card. Also, let me know if your card was graduated. I asked today, and they're still not graduating anymore.

Re: What's the total of your Capital One CLI for your secured card?

Well, for once CSR gave the correct answer 

Cap One is currently not graduating secured cards, and even during the brief period that they did, those cards did not receive any CLIs past the Steps increase. 

 

You wont find anyone with different experience when it comes to cap one secured or formerly secured cards. They are dead end.

Re: What's the total of your Capital One CLI for your secured card?

Cap1 started my secured with a $250 limit and one CLI to $500 after five months, and it never moved from there. I called and was told it wasn’t and wouldn’t ever be eligible for increases or graduation.

I applied for two other cap1 cards a year after opening it (used their prequal tool for a Quicksilver and cold-apped a co-branded card within minutes of each other - single pull to all three bureaus) and just closed the secured after I got a couple of years of history on the newer cards.
